McKayla Maroney, a former Olympic gymnast, testified at a hearing on the FBI's handling of the investigation of Larry Nassar for sexual abuse allegations. She spoke about the abuse she faced and how not enough was done as the investigation continued. This video includes testimony some viewers may find upsetting or disturbing.
